8 Tips for choosing good barber?

- Ask around: It’s always best to ask your friends, family, or colleagues for recommendations when you’re looking for a barber. You can also check online directories. Make sure to read any reviews or customer feedback that is available.
- Services and qualifications: Make sure you know what services are available and what qualifications the barber has. Ask to see their qualifications, as well as any customer testimonials.
- Experience: Experience counts, so make sure to ask the barber how long they have been in business and how many years of experience they have. It’s also important to make sure the barber is knowledgeable about the latest trends and techniques.
- Tools and products: Good barbers use quality tools and products. Ask if their tools are sanitized between customers, and what type of products they use. Make sure they use products that are safe and appropriate for your hair type.
- Pricing: When it comes to pricing, make sure the barber’s rates are within your budget. You should also ask about any extra fees, such as tips or taxes.
- Cleanliness: Cleanliness is important when it comes to barbershops. Make sure the barber and their shop are clean and hygienic.
- Scheduling: Make sure the barber has convenient hours and can accommodate your schedule. It’s also a good idea to ask if they offer any appointment discounts or specials.
- Comfort: Comfort is key when you’re selecting a barber. Make sure you’re comfortable with the barber’s level of professionalism, as well as how they treat their customers. Ask if you can watch them cut a few customers’ hair before making your decision.
